Avant-garde: Something that is on the cutting edge, particulary in the arts. Avant la lettre: Something so much on the … dr black wellsboroWebThis French slang phrase means ‘very stylish’. Whether you’re admiring their hair or their clothes, they’ll instantly get your meaning when you throw this phrase into the conversation. Usage example: J’adore tes cheveux. Trop stylé. Tu es allé chez le couffeur? I love your hair. Very stylish. Did you go to the hairdresser?
